What Problem Does This Solve?
Many financial services firms attempt to integrate RAG capabilities using general-purpose automation platforms like Zapier or Make, or by adapting basic SaaS solutions. While these tools offer surface-level convenience, their inherent "one-size-fits-all" design becomes a critical bottleneck in the highly specialized financial world. Generic platforms lack the deep customization needed for complex financial documents, often struggling with parsing nuanced legal clauses, numerical data within reports, or multi-page policy structures. They impose rigid data connectors and limited API access, preventing seamless integration with proprietary legacy systems or specialized financial databases. Furthermore, security protocols in off-the-shelf tools rarely meet the stringent compliance standards (e.g., GDPR, CCPA, SOX) vital for financial data. You risk data leakage, compliance breaches, and inaccurate retrieval due to generalized embeddings and retrieval strategies not optimized for financial jargon and context. Relying on such tools can lead to retrieval inaccuracies exceeding 30%, wasting valuable analyst time, and potentially causing costly regulatory missteps.
